+//Example 1.18:Classsification of a system:Linearity Property
+//Page 54
+//To check whether the given discrete system is a Linear System (or) Non-Linear System
+//Given discrete system y(t)= (x(t)^2)
+clear;
+clc;
+x1 = [1,1,1,1];
+x2 = [2,2,2,2];
+a = 1;
+b = 1;
+for t = 1:length(x1)
+ x3(t) = a*x1(t)+b*x2(t);
+end
+for t = 1:length(x1)
+ y1(t) = (x1(t)^2);
+ y2(t) = (x2(t)^2);
+ y3(t) = (x3(t)^2);
+end
+for t = 1:length(y1)
+ z(t) = a*y1(t)+b*y2(t);
+end
+count = 0;
+for n =1:length(y1)
+ if(y3(t)== z(t))
+ count = count+1;
+ end
+end
+if(count == length(y3))
+ disp('Since It satisifies the superposition principle')
+ disp('The given system is a Linear system')
+ y3
+ z
+ else
+ disp('Since It does not satisify the superposition principle')
+ disp('The given system is a Non-Linear system')
+end
